The Kano State Hisbah Board has arrested 26 women during a raid on a hotel in the Kano metropolis over alleged immoral activities.
The operation, which took place on Saturday, followed complaints from residents about suspicious acts taking place at the facility.
Speaking on Monday, the Deputy Commander General of Hisbah, Dr. Mujahid Aminuddeen, confirmed that the raid was carried out with assistance from military authorities.

“We appreciate the military commanders for their support, which made the operation successful,” he said.
According to him, many of the suspects were found intoxicated, and several cartons of alcohol were seized from the premises.
Aminuddeen urged residents to continue reporting similar cases of immoral activities in hotels or residential areas, assuring that the board would take prompt action.
He also noted that such operations would be sustained as part of efforts to curb indecent behavior across Kano State.
